From: Alan Modra Date: Wed, 1 Oct 2025 03:59:27 +0000 (+0930) Subject: Remove tic4x_scan always false condition X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=dece3865c2d6420e8193598a33e8a9cd71598547;p=thirdparty%2Fbinutils-gdb.git Remove tic4x_scan always false condition The numeric check was always false, and correcting it to match the comment causes lots of testsuite failures. "tic4x" is a valid string. * cpu-tic4x.c (tic4x_scan): Remove always false condition. Fix comment. --- diff --git a/bfd/cpu-tic4x.c b/bfd/cpu-tic4x.c index 0cfacf3c0eb..e154b8fa3f0 100644 --- a/bfd/cpu-tic4x.c +++ b/bfd/cpu-tic4x.c @@ -28,15 +28,12 @@ static bool tic4x_scan (const struct bfd_arch_info *info, const char *string) { - /* Allow strings of form [ti][Cc][34][0-9], let's not be too picky + /* Allow strings of form [ti][Cc][34], let's not be too picky about strange numbered machines in C3x or C4x series. */ if (string[0] == 't' && string[1] == 'i') string += 2; if (*string == 'C' || *string == 'c') string++; - if (string[1] < '0' && string[1] > '9') - return false; - if (*string == '3') return (info->mach == bfd_mach_tic3x); else if (*string == '4')